Account recovery — Bramblekit hermetic migration

If your builder account locks during the cutover to the Stonejar hermetic toolchain, do not re-register. Open the recovery console on the bastion, select the Stonejar realm, and choose "restore builder identity." The console then prompts for the team recovery passphrase, which follows below.

unlock words, hahip-baduf: holwyn-istath-julvan

Ticket: Staging env misconfigured for Siftgate bloom filter

The bloom layer in front of the Pellet KV store is rejecting all lookups in staging because the env file was copied from the dev template without credentials. False-positive tuning values are fine; only the auth line is missing. To unblock the weekly demo, the Pellet admission secret must be set on the following line.

env line for yaguf-fajop: LEDGER_TOKEN13=fb08984397349

## Service Accounts — Tenant Quotas (Plugin Authors)

Each plugin on the Quarrel platform runs under its own service account. Rate quotas are per-tenant: 600 reads/min, 120 writes/min by default. Quota counters live in the Meterbox service; exceeding a quota returns 429 with a `retry-after` header. Do not pool accounts across tenants — enforcement is per-account and pooling will starve your users. To query your current quota usage from Meterbox, authenticate with the sandbox key below.

API key for yahig-tadup: kto7_ubizbYm

Handover Note — From R. Calvi to incoming director. The main open item is customer concentration: Ardenfell Systems now accounts for 41% of annual revenue at the Mersworth plant, up from 28% two years ago. Their contract renews in March and procurement there has signalled a competitive tender. Diversification efforts with two smaller accounts are early-stage. Our mitigation approach is recorded below.

board note of baguf-fafog: Kasixox Foods plans to lower the Drueth list price by 48 percent in March.